General Info
In Block
d509a03ec4a4c85f5d3492667119c967997bec8b93974413ff20bb886de4808b
In block height
Total Input
4000.24025151 RDD
Total Output
4000.23925151 RDD
Transaction Details
Fee
0.001 RDD
mined Wed, 18 Jun 2014 18:09:50 UTC
From
3960.24025151 RDDFrom
From
From
From